I'm trying to delete a blog post on blogger.com using Blogger API via Prototype Javascript library. Here's my code:

var request = new Ajax.Request(
    'http://www.blogger.com/feeds/'+remoteBlogId+'/posts/default/'+postId
    {
        method:'DELETE',
        requestHeaders:['Authorization', 'GoogleLogin auth='+authKey],
        on200:function(){/*onSuccess*/},
        onFailure:function(){/*onFailure*/}
    }
);

As far as I can see from API description, everything's alright, but when I run this, it fires onSuccess function, but doesn't delete the entry on the server.

I guess that Prototype doesn't work well with HTTP methods other than GET and POST (here's the ticket describing similar problem though proposed patch didn't work for me)
